Originally Posted by PinchFlat
I went out to to my xB at lunch today and there was a crack that wasn't there this morning when I left it???? and no chip where the crack started (on the edge inder the trim)? Just cracked???

Is this a warrente issue? anyone else have it just crack?
Mine happenned one month into ownership. I handwashed and dryed it in the driveway in the evening. No crack, figured I would have seen it if there was one when I was drying it. Pulled it into the garage for "safe" overnight storage after drying. Get in the garage ready to head to work the next morning and WTF a crack starting from under the top trim and running across in a "J" shape. THAT SUCKS. I personally think that the glass is too thin or of cheap material. I could actually feel the crack and if you placed pressure on it, you could feel the glass move. I think there should be some type of recall by the NHTSA. I'm **** about where I park and drive. I don't care who is in the car, but we're all walking from the boonies of the parking lot to get where we need to go. Can we petition for a recall of some sort?
